Beverley’s squad continues to grow

Beverley Town’s squad continues to grow with a host of new faces and players from their last season in the Humber Premier League.

Staying at Beverley are Danny Finch and Joe Norton after playing for the club in the HPL during the Mike Thompson era.

Beverley’s new goalkeeper is Sam Riches who played for Glasshoughton Welfare last season.

Young defender Harry Griffin joins from Hall Road Rangers along with Alex Knaggs who will reconnect his centre-half partnership with James Piercy.

Also arriving from Hall Road are striker Reece Moody and Lewis Gibson.

Beverley drew 1-1 with Brigg Town in their first pre-season friendly.

Next up is tomorrow night’s trip to Frickley Athletic.
